iOS 系统虚拟现实 (VR) 游戏操作系统专业知识62

随着虚拟现实 (VR) 技术的不断发展,VR 游戏正在迅速成为移动平台上的热门选择。苹果的 iOS 操作系统凭借其强大的硬件功能和丰富的开发人员生态系统,已成为 VR 游戏开发的理想平台。

iOS VR 游戏的独特优势

* 强大的硬件:较新的 iOS 设备配备了强大的处理器、高分辨率显示屏和精确的运动传感器,可提供出色的 VR 体验。* 专用的 VR 框架:Apple 提供了 SceneKit 和 RealityKit 等专用的 VR 框架,可以简化 VR 游戏的开发并优化性能。* 广泛的开发人员支持:iOS 拥有一个庞大的开发者社区,他们积极开发针对 VR 的创新应用和游戏。

iOS VR 游戏的系统架构

iOS VR 游戏的系统架构通常涉及以下组件:

* 应用程序:VR 游戏应用程序包含游戏逻辑、图形渲染和用户交互处理。* VR 框架:SceneKit 或 RealityKit 等 VR 框架提供与 VR 设备的底层接口,处理显示、跟踪和输入。* 操作系统:iOS 操作系统为 VR 游戏提供底层操作系统支持,管理内存、资源和安全。* 硬件:iOS 设备的硬件组件,如显示屏、处理器和运动传感器,提供 VR 体验的基础。

优化 iOS VR 游戏性能

为了优化 iOS VR 游戏的性能,开发人员可以使用以下技术:

* 图像优化:使用 LOD(细节级别)技术、剔除算法和纹理压缩来减少渲染开销。* 多线程处理:利用多核 CPU 同时处理多个任务,以提高性能。* VR 特定的优化:使用 VR 框架提供的优化功能,例如单视渲染和时间扭曲。* 硬件限制:了解 iOS 设备的硬件限制并相应地调整游戏设置。

案例研究:著名 iOS VR 游戏

许多流行的 VR 游戏已针对 iOS 平台进行优化,展示了该平台的 VR 游戏潜力:

* InMind VR:一款叙事冒险游戏,玩家通过探索人类的思想来解开谜题。* Beat Saber:一款节奏游戏,玩家使用光剑击中迎面而来的音符。* Vader Immortal:一款以《星球大战》为背景的沉浸式 VR 体验,玩家可以使用光剑与敌人作战。

iOS 系统凭借其强大的硬件、专用的 VR 框架和广泛的开发者支持,为 VR 游戏开发提供了理想的平台。通过优化性能和充分利用 iOS 的 VR 游戏优势,开发人员可以创建引人入胜且令人难忘的 VR 游戏体验。

2024-10-11


上一篇:Linux 系统网络配置全指南

下一篇:华为鸿蒙 OS 系统升级:深入解析其技术革新和用户体验提升